使用do...while双重循环输出直角三角形
时间: 2024-05-09 15:16:58 浏览: 52
巧妙使用do……while
好的,很高兴为您解答。请看以下代码:
```
#include <stdio.h>
int main() {
int i = 1, j = 1;
do {
do {
printf("*");
j++;
} while (j <= i);
printf("\n");
j = 1;
i++;
} while (i <= 5);
return 0;
}
```
这段代码可以输出一个边长为 5 的直角三角形,您可以根据需要修改 i 和 j 的最大值来输出不同大小的直角三角形。希望可以帮到您。
阅读全文